Setting Privilege Levels for a Group of Commands

You can set the privilege level for a group of commands by using the beginning keyword in a command.

For example, if you issue the privilege configure all level 5 snmp command, all commands in Global Configuration mode that begin with snmp become accessible to users who have CLI privileges at level 5 and higher.
